You can build your list by leveraging existing subscribers. Word of mouth is ideal for gaining more exposure, so ask your subscribers to refer their friends to join your mailing list too. You might choose to add a “tell a friend” form on your website or directing them to it from an email. Ask them to forward your newsletter to their friends if they like it. There are many ways you can encourage your subscribers to help you build your mailing list, but it all starts with simple word of mouth. Freebies are a great way to entice new subscriptions for your list. You can drive new membership to your list by offering free eBooks, tools, reports, or software. Let your subscribers know they are welcome to share your eBook freely if you want to get even more exposure.
